Why WordPress is the Best CMS? – 15 Reasons

WordPress is the most popular content management system (CMS) in the world.

Over 40% of websites on the internet are built using this platform WordPress.

There are many reasons why WordPress is the best CMS, and in this article, we will explore some of them.

Easy to Use

One of the biggest reasons why WordPress is the best CMS is its ease of use.

Even if you don’t have any technical knowledge, you can still create a website with WordPress.

The platform has a user-friendly interface that allows you to create pages, posts, and menus with just a few clicks.

You can also install plugins and themes to customise your site without any coding knowledge.

Customizable

WordPress is highly customizable, and you can use it to create any type of website.
Whether you want to create a blog, an online store, or a portfolio site, WordPress has you covered.

There are thousands of free and paid themes and plugins available that you can use to customise your site.

You can also hire a developer to create a custom theme or plugin for you if you have specific requirements.

SEO Friendly

WordPress is built with SEO in mind, and it is optimised for search engines.

The platform allows you to add meta tags and descriptions, which help search engines understand the content of your site.

You can also use plugins like Yoast SEO to further optimise your site for search engines.

Security

Security is a major concern for any website owner.

WordPress takes security very seriously and regularly releases updates to fix any vulnerabilities.

You can also use plugins like Wordfence or Sucuri to add an extra layer of security to your site.

E-commerce Friendly

If you want to create an online store, WordPress has many e-commerce plugins that you can use.

The most popular e-commerce plugin for WordPress is WooCommerce.

It allows you to create a fully functional online store.

Simple Backup and One Click Restore

You can take a backup of your website to your computer with one click. You can also automate your backup process to remote storage like Google Drive.

The plugin like Updraftplus will help you in this task.

There are a lot of other plugins to make this process.

Just you have to install the backup plugin and have to set up the backup process.

You can restore your website from this backup with a single click.

More Plugins Repository

The major advantage with WordPress CMS is its plugins. Yes, WordPress plugins are the game changer in WordPress.

For a particular task there is a particular plugin.

If you want to create contact forms there are plugins like WPForms, Contact Form 7 etc.

If you want to create tables in WordPress blog posts then you can use the plugins like TablePress, WP Table Builder etc.

Multi-language Support

WordPress is available in many languages, which means that you can create a site in any language you want.

This is important if you have a global audience and want to reach people who speak different languages.

You can also use plugins like WPML or Polylang to create a multilingual site.

Cost-Effective

WordPress is a cost-effective way to create a website.

The platform is free to use, and you can find many free themes and plugins in the WordPress repository.

You only need to pay for hosting and a domain name, which can be as low as a few dollars a month.
